## Loyalty Ledger Access for Plugin Authors

Plugins built for the Merivale Rewards platform read the points ledger through a read-only replica. Each earn or burn event is an immutable row; never attempt updates. Rate limits apply per plugin key. For local development against the sandbox ledger, connect using the string below.

warehouse DSN: clickhouse://druys_svc:Pl@db-47e1.orvexstack.corp:5432/beldor

**Runbook: restarting the Chalkline timetable solver**

Heads up for security review: the solver runs as a non-root worker and only reads the schedules DB, never writes. If it wedges (usually a constraint loop on split classes), drain the queue, restart the pod, and replay from the last checkpoint. No secrets live in the container; creds come from the vault sidecar. Each restart logs a trace token, shown below.

pipeline stamp: htk4_b7f3

Hey Priya — handing over the Quillbase static-analysis setup. Heads up: the baseline file (`sa-baseline.yml`) suppresses about 140 legacy findings so new PRs stay clean. Don't let anyone add fresh suppressions without a ticket — that's the whole game. I've been burning down roughly ten entries a sprint. The suppression policy and the burn-down tracker are on the page below.

runbook for fajep-yahop: https://rundeck.braskdata.example/repo/run/pages/job/dfe5b8c563356906

Priya — handing over the string-extraction script before the Larkspur 4.2 freeze. It walks the component tree nightly and writes candidate keys to the staging catalog, but it does not delete removed strings; you must run the prune pass manually before each release cut, or translators get billed for dead entries. Watch for interpolated keys — the script flags them as warnings, and any warning in the final run should block the cut. The step-by-step release checklist is kept on the internal page.

operations page: https://jenkins.zemvarcloud.local/job/merge_requests/repo/build/73930b4b30f0a8ed